BESAN COCONUT BARFI

This Diwali I made besan( gram flour) and coconut Barfi, and everyone loved it, so thought of posting it but i forgot to take the picture, so i am writing the recipe will post the picture next time whenevr i make it. Ingredients..... 2cups gram flour 2cups grated coconut 1 cup khoya (mawa) 2 and half cup sugar 1 and half cup water half cup desi ghee Roast the gram flour with ghee o0n a medium firt and then low heat....when it starts leaving the sides take it off. Roast the coconut a little and keep it aside Roast the khoya a little on a very low heat and keep it aside. Now in a pan take sugar and water and make syrup of 3-4 consistency....to chk it take alittle(be caustious as its very hot) betweween your fore finger and thumb and seee that while stretching how many threads you see..its a thick consistency....then put all the things and take it off the heat and mix quickly thoroughly..... and shift it to a greased plate....and let it cool Then cut into the pieces.

NAMKEEN DALIA

This is a very healthy breakfast for me and I like it also, almost no oil is used and it has lots of vegetables. and not much cooking even. Ingredients:----- 1cup broken wheat 250 gm cabbage..julienned 1small capsicum..julienned 1 carrot grated 1 tsp. oil 1tsp. mustard seeds. 1/2 tsp. turmeric 1/2 tsp salt or as you like it 1/2 lemon 2 tbsp. roasted peanuts. Green chilli (optional) coriander leaves..finely chopped for garnishing. Dry roast the broken wheat, till it is golden. In a pan put oil, and when it is hot add mustard seeds. When they start spluttering add all the vegetables. saute them for 5-8 minutes, till they get shiny or loose water. Keep them aside. Now cook the broken wheat with 2 cup water, turmeric and salt, slow the fire and cook till all the water is absorbed. Mix the vegetables in this. Now while serving spread some peanuts and then sprinkle lemon. TIPS:.....even you can roast the wheat in microwave also, you will have to stir it once or twice. Some people add tomatoe
